Went to Heenan on Friday 09-02 for the opener. Got there alittle late as usual. Parked at the lower lot, as the upper lot was full, and cars etc. were parking on the road into the main lot. There was only one other person parked down there. When I left there was one more parked down there. Put in at the dam. And kicked around the dam for awhile then went along the shore (south) towards the stocking area and then all around the shore back to the dam. I got my fish (4) to net and 2-3 I lost while on the south/west shore. Nothing seemed to happen for me until I shortened up the amount of line (type 4 full sink) I had in the water. Then I started to get bit. Not sure if this had any bearing on my success or not, but after the change things started to happen plus I was only using one fly rig, a black wolly bugger seemed to do the trick for me. I did dry all sorts of combinations, purple bugger, green bugger, with hairs ear droppers and prince nymphs also. But what worked was a single fly (black) with no dropper, and 5X tippet. Talked to a guy who was throwing metal lures, cast master, and he said he had caught 14 fish. The metal thowers (killers) were doing well catching fish, but the guy said he has a fly rod that he leaves home as he said he has A.D.D. and can't be that patient. I would guess that the Sat/Sun was a zoo there. I would say on Friday maybe 15-20 tubes and some kayaks and a few boats with electric motors. I will be going back some time soon to see if I can get lucky again. This was my 4th or 5th time going to Heenan and I have been skunked until this time, and it was worth it. No I didn't get alot of fish, but I broke my jinx at this lake. My wife does well there. The wind was calm all day for the most part. Every once in a while some would kick up, but nothing unmanageable. Maybe the fishing will get better as the whether gets colder. Was listening to others in boats, spin casting with lures or trolling and seems some were not as successful as the guy I talked to.
